#8c0059 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8c0059 is composed of 54.9% red, 0%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 321.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 27.5%. #8c0059 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00b2 with #190000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#8c0059 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8c0059 has RGB values of R:140, G:0,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.36,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9175129.

Shades and Tints of #8c0059
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#ffeef9 is the lightest one.
